15-year-old missing person case gets update after new technology

  • Oregon officials and the FBI are renewing efforts to find a missing person who disappeared nearly 15 years ago.

In a significant development in a 15-year-old missing person case, new technology has provided a crucial update, as reported by Newsweek on February 22, 2023. The case involves a young girl who disappeared in 2008, and recent advancements in forensic genealogy have led to the identification of a potential suspect. This breakthrough came after the re-examination of DNA evidence using modern techniques, which were not available at the time of the initial investigation. The suspect, whose identity has not been disclosed to the public, is currently under investigation, marking a pivotal moment in the long-standing effort to solve this case and bring closure to the family of the missing girl.
